In a surprising turn of events, it has been alleged that former President Donald Trump will be making a visit to a McDonald’s in Pennsylvania this Sunday to work the fry cooker. This news comes after Trump publicly stated that Vice President Kamala Harris had never worked at the fast-food chain, despite her claims to the contrary. The information was shared by Eric Daugherty on Twitter on October 15, 2024.
